Filipino Social Club celebrates heritage, unity, and creativity in Dubai.
Dubai: Get ready, Dubai! The Filipino Social Club (FilSoc) is set to light up the Dubai World Trade Centre on June 14, 2025, with a spectacular celebration of Filipino culture, unity, and pride. In honor of the 127th Philippine Independence Day, this landmark event is open to all nationalities and promises an unforgettable day filled with color, creativity, and community spirit.
This year’s theme — “Filipino pride: Embracing diversity, celebrating unity and love of country” — sets the tone for a day-long cultural extravaganza that highlights the richness of Filipino heritage while embracing the vibrant multicultural spirit of the UAE.
“This year’s celebration is more than a tribute to our independence — it’s an expression of who we are as a people, and how our culture continues to evolve and inspire, even far from home,” says Ericson Reyes, President of the Filipino Social Club Dubai.

The theme aligns with the UAE’s “Year of Community”, making the event a meaningful bridge between cultures and generations.
Key program highlights include the Philippine Festivals Dance Competition, a Mr. and Ms. Kalayaan 2025 pageant spotlighting multicultural Filipino youth. There will also be a Munting Ginoo at Binibining Kalayaan Filipiniana Fashion Show, and a Philippine Choral Festival.
Other featured segments which were aimed at the participation of the Filipino youth include Modern Balagtasan, Likha ng Siyensya (Robotics & Innovation Challenge), Artistic Baybayin, Tula at Pinta (Live Poetry and Painting Competition), Pinoy Cosplay Fiesta, and a wide array of interactive side events like Baybayin contests, a bike and toy exhibit, local art market (Kalye Arte), and family-friendly “peryahan” games.Youth power and community spirit
From planning to performance, this event is powered by the Filipino community itself, with a huge emphasis on youth participation.
“Young volunteers, creatives, and influencers have truly shaped this year’s program,” Rey says. “They’re injecting fresh energy — whether it’s through cosplay, modern performances, or artistic expressions of Filipino identity. It’s their way of honoring the past while creating the future.”
With over 40 accredited Filipino groups contributing to the event, the sense of community is not just visible — it’s electric.
